It's generally believed that a 90% compliance rate is necessary in order for a quarantine to be "effective," Mark A. Rothstein, director of the Institute for Bioethics, Health Policy and Law at the University of Louisville School of Medicine, who studies income replacement programs, tells CNBC Make It. You may be eligible for a 500 payment to support you during self-isolation if you live in England and you: If you are not on one of these benefits, you might still be eligible for a 500 discretionary payment if all the following apply: Your local council will tell you what counts as low income and financial hardship and whether you are eligible. If youre an employee, include the total of the self-isolation supportscheme payments youvereceived in the Other benefits (including interest-free and low interest loans) box of the Benefits from your employment section of SA102.
